If that never happens for some reason > (buggy init script, corrupt root filesystem or whatnot) but the kernel > itself is fine, the machine stays up indefinitely. This patch allows > setting an upper limit for how long the kernel will take care of the > watchdog, thus ensuring that the watchdog will eventually reset the > machine. > > This is particularly useful for embedded devices where some fallback > logic is implemented in the bootloader (e.g., use a different root > partition, boot from network, ...). > > The open timeout is also used as a maximum time for an application to > re-open /dev/watchdogN after closing it. > > A value of 0 (the default) means infinite timeout, preserving the > current behaviour. > > The unit is milliseconds rather than seconds because that covers more > use cases. For example, one can effectively disable the kernel handling > by setting the open_timeout to 1 ms. There are also customers with very > strict requirements that may want to set the open_timeout to something > like 4500 ms, which combined with a hardware watchdog that must be > pinged every 250 ms ensures userspace is up no more than 5 seconds after > the bootloader hands control to the kernel (250 ms until the driver gets > registered and kernel handling starts, 4500 ms of kernel handling, and > then up to 250 ms from the last ping until userspace takes over). > > Signed-off-by: Rasmus Villemoes I finally found the time to look into this.
